Ninety Six is a town of 2,000 people in Upcountry South Carolina. Ninety Six benefits from tourism to its historic site and nearby state park, along with events such as the Festival of Stars, a Fourth of July celebration that is hosted yearly by the town. Ninety Six is situated 3½ miles southeast of Pinehurst.

Greenwood is a city in and the county seat of Greenwood County, South Carolina. The population in the 2020 United States Census was 22,545 down from 23,222 at the 2010 census. The city is home to Lander University.
